Analysis
Russian Federation recorded 1.32 million for school age population, early childhood educational development in 2025.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 4.6% on the previous year and down 32.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, school age population, early childhood educational development in Russian Federation peaked at 1.98 million in 2017 and was at its lowest, 1.28 million, in 2002.
That places Russian Federation 11th out of 102 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 28 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1.34 million | 1.31 million | 1.37 million | 2 |
| 2000s | 1.41 million | 1.28 million | 1.56 million | 10 |
| 2010s | 1.85 million | 1.68 million | 1.98 million | 10 |
| 2020s | 1.49 million | 1.32 million | 1.69 million | 6 |
